隐藏Outlook 2003中的内置“发送”按钮

时间:2010-01-27 12:58:26

标签: button hide send outlook-2003

我正在使用ms-outlook 2003,我想隐藏内置发送按钮并使用自定义按钮发送邮件。

由于我曾经使用C,C ++和Java,不知道如何使用VB / VBScript / VBA,任何机构都可以告诉我如何隐藏此按钮以及如何从自定义按钮发送邮件,如何访问邮件领域(即,TO字段,主题字段,Msg正文,附件等)。

1 个答案:

答案 0 :(得分:0)

如果你想这样做,你必须通过它的ID获得对该按钮的引用。然后,您可以控制它的属性,如启用/禁用它。

VB

Set oCommandBars = Item.GetInspector.CommandBars
Set oStandardBar = oCommandBars("Standard")

Counter = 1

For Counter = 1 To oStandardBar.Controls.Count
    If oStandardBar.Controls(Counter).ID = "1975" Then
        oStandardBar.Controls(Counter).Enabled = False
        Exit For
    End If
Next

但是,正如Lazarus所说,有许多方法可以给猫皮肤提供更多的解释方法可能会有所帮助,您是否正在使用Addin或通过自动化等方式进行此操作?